Output 4205415bb155680d3278bfbdf775a3e95ad0966575da521fc56f6ed73aec0583:0

value
65481759
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c25ad8bf106f7bebe54aec91502e536b1671831 OP_EQUALVERIFY OP_CHECKSIG
address
LdqPFFgZyDK4qGr9yrGfzMuDEjWETXPufk
transaction
4205415bb155680d3278bfbdf775a3e95ad0966575da521fc56f6ed73aec0583
spent
true